Bloomington native tied to famous UFO case to speak on unexplained phenomena

John Burroughs, whose account of the Rendlesham Forest incident helped make it one of the worlds most famous UFO cases, is bringing a UFO conference to Bloomington and will discuss his decades-long effort to obtain medical benefits for health challenges related to the event.
